Tubulated Adapter

Vacuum Tubulated Adapter is a core adapter fitting in vacuum systems, whose primary function is to enable seamless connection between vacuum pipes/equipment with different standard interfaces, pipe diameters, or materials.

Conical Reducing Adapter

Vacuum Conical Reducing Adapter is a core vacuum system component, enabling precise transitional connection between pipes/equipment of different diameters or interface standards. Its conical design integrates high sealing, low flow resistance, and structural stability, ensuring leak-free vacuum integrity.

VCR Adapter

The Vacuum VCR Adapter is a high-precision connecting component based on VCR (Vacuum Coupling Retainer) vacuum coupling locking technology, achieving zero-leakage sealing through its "metal hard seal + locking structure.

Rubber Hose Adapter

The Vacuum Rubber Hose Adapter is a flexible adapter in vacuum systems specifically designed for precise connection between rubber hoses, pipes, and equipment interfaces. It effectively absorbs pipeline vibrations, compensates for installation deviations, while maintaining the vacuum tightness of the system.

Swagelok Adapter

Vacuum Swagelok Adapter is a high-precision vacuum adapter based on Swagelok's core ferrule sealing technology. Designed for precise connection of pipes, equipment, and different interfaces in vacuum systems, it delivers high sealing performance and structural stability via "ferrule sealing + precision structure.

Quick Disconnect Adapter

Vacuum Quick Disconnect Adapter is a high-precision connecting component designed specifically for quick assembly/disassembly in vacuum systems, compatible with low, medium, and high vacuum conditions.

What are the common types of vacuum adapters?

The common types of vacuum adapters have Tubulated Adapter, Conical Reducing Adapter, VCR Adapter, Rubber Hose Adapter, Swagelok Adapter and Quick Disconnect Adapter.

How to choose a suitable vacuum adapter based on vacuum system requirements?

Vacuum level matching:Low/medium vacuum (≥10⁻⁵ Pa): Rubber-sealed adapters such as KF, threaded, or hose adapters (e.g., Rubber Hose Adapter) can be selected;High/ultra-high vacuum (<10⁻⁵ Pa): Metal-sealed adapters like CF, VCR, or Swagelok adapters must be chosen to ensure low leak rates.

Interface compatibility: Select the corresponding adapter according to the interface type of the components to be connected in the system (such as flanges, threads, ferrules). For example, when connecting a KF flange to a steel pipe, a KF to Swagelok reducing adapter can be selected.

How to correctly install a vacuum adapter?

To correctly install a vacuum adapter, it is necessary to ensure reliable sealing and stable connection. The steps are as follows: clean the interfaces, install the seals, align accurately, fasten evenly, and verify leak tightness.

What materials are vacuum adapters made of?

Common materials and their applicable scenarios:Stainless steel (304/316): Corrosion-resistant and high-temperature resistant, suitable for high-vacuum and corrosive environments.

How to troubleshoot air leakage in vacuum adapters during use?

1)Check the seals: See if they are aged, damaged, or mismatched in size.

2)Clean the sealing surfaces: Check for oil stains or scratches, then clean or polish them for repair.

3)Inspect tightness: Check if flange bolts are evenly tightened, and if threads/ferrules are loose or over-tightened.

4)Check the material: Corrosive media may corrode the material, causing air leakage.

5)Use tools: Locate the leak with a helium leak detector or soapy water, then replace or repair accordingly.
